Fleas are tiny insects that survive by feeding on blood from animals and sometimes humans. They reproduce quickly, laying eggs in carpets, bedding, and cracks in flooring. In Adrian, Michigan, fleas often enter homes through dogs, cats, or rodents. Once inside, they can become established within days.
Ticks behave differently but are just as dangerous. They are commonly found in grassy yards, wooded areas, and places where wildlife moves through. In Adrian, ticks attach to pets or people passing through outdoor spaces and can be brought inside without being noticed.
Our Adrian emergency pest exterminators often see infestations worsen when early signs are ignored. Fleas can reproduce in large numbers in a short time, while ticks can hide in corners, furniture seams, and pet resting areas.
Adrian has seasonal conditions that support flea and tick activity. Warm months create ideal breeding environments, while cooler months push pests indoors where they survive longer than expected.

Rodent activity in homes around Adrian, especially during colder months in Lenawee County, often involves mice or rats seeking warmth and food. The first step is to reduce access to food by sealing pantry items in hard containers and cleaning up crumbs or spills immediately. It is also important to identify possible entry points such as gaps near utility lines, basement foundation cracks, or poorly sealed garage doors. While waiting for professional assistance, avoid disturbing nesting areas, as rodents may scatter and move deeper into wall voids. Keeping pets away from suspected activity zones can also help reduce stress and contamination risks.
Bed bug outbreaks in multi-unit buildings in Adrian can spread quickly between adjoining apartments through walls, outlets, and shared hallways. The most important step is to avoid moving infested furniture or clothing between rooms, as this can worsen the spread. Washing bedding and clothing in hot water followed by high-heat drying helps reduce active insects and eggs. Vacuuming mattress seams, bed frames, and nearby carpet edges can help remove visible bugs and shed skins. Coordination with property management is important so adjacent units can be inspected, since untreated neighboring spaces often lead to reinfestation.
Ant activity in Adrian increases significantly during spring and summer when species like pavement ants and carpenter ants search for food and moisture. Kitchens are common entry points because of exposed food, sugary spills, and pet bowls left out overnight. Ants often follow scent trails established by scouts, which is why small sightings can quickly turn into larger infestations. Cleaning surfaces with vinegar-based solutions can help disrupt these trails temporarily. Outdoor conditions such as heavy rain or dry spells in Lenawee County can also push colonies indoors in search of stable resources.
Wasps in Adrian commonly build nests under eaves, porch ceilings, sheds, and tree branches during late spring and summer. If a nest is discovered, it is important to avoid sudden movements or disturbing it, as wasps can become defensive quickly. Keeping outdoor areas clear of sweet drinks and food waste can reduce attraction. Monitoring nest size from a safe distance helps assess activity levels without interference. Evening hours are typically when wasps are less active, but any direct handling of nests should be approached with caution due to their protective behavior.
Termite activity in older Adrian homes can be difficult to detect early because damage often occurs behind walls or under flooring. Common indicators include hollow-sounding wood, blistering paint, and small mud tubes along foundation walls or crawl spaces. Discarded wings near windowsills may also suggest swarm activity during seasonal emergence. Moisture-prone areas such as basements and poorly ventilated crawl spaces are especially vulnerable in Michigan’s climate. Regularly checking wooden structures in contact with soil can help identify early structural weakening.
Stink bugs commonly enter homes in Adrian during early fall as temperatures begin to drop. They seek sheltered indoor spaces such as attics, window frames, and wall voids to overwinter. These insects are attracted to warm surfaces on sunny sides of buildings and often cluster in large numbers. Sealing cracks around windows and doors can reduce entry points, especially in older structures. While they do not typically damage property, their presence can become a nuisance when they gather indoors during colder months.
Mosquito populations in Adrian increase significantly near wetlands, ponds, and slow-moving water such as areas around the River Raisin watershed. Standing water provides ideal breeding conditions where eggs develop into larvae within days. Warm, humid summer conditions in southeastern Michigan accelerate their life cycle. Removing stagnant water from containers, gutters, and yard features can help reduce breeding sites. Vegetation close to homes also provides resting areas, making outdoor maintenance important for reducing mosquito activity near living spaces.
Bats occasionally enter attics in Adrian homes through small openings in roofing or vents, especially during warmer months when they seek roosting sites. It is important to avoid direct contact and keep the area quiet to reduce stress on the animal. Identifying entry points such as gaps near soffits or chimneys helps determine how the bat entered. Sealing openings should only be done after confirming that no bats are inside the structure. Attics with bat activity may also show staining or droppings near entry points.
Spiders in Adrian commonly enter basements, garages, and crawl spaces in search of insects to feed on and sheltered environments. These areas often provide low light, moisture, and minimal disturbance, making them ideal hiding spots. Common species include house spiders and cellar spiders that build webs in corners and ceiling edges. Reducing clutter and sealing cracks in foundation walls can limit their hiding areas. Since spiders follow insect activity, controlling other pests in the home often reduces spider presence over time.
Raccoons in Adrian neighborhoods often enter attics or rummage through garbage in search of food and shelter, especially in suburban areas with easy roof access. In attics, they may damage insulation, ductwork, and wooden structures while creating nesting sites. Outdoor garbage bins can attract them if lids are not securely fastened. Noises such as scratching or movement at night are common signs of activity. Preventing access points by securing roof vents and keeping outdoor waste tightly sealed helps reduce encounters with these animals.
